JSP九大内置对象详解全析(七):pageContext对象 原创 wx5bddc0ab0cfc8 2021-07-14 10:31:49 ©著作权 文章标签 Servlet JSP 内置对象 config 文章分类 前端开发 ©著作权归作者所有:来自51CTO博客作者wx5bddc0ab0cfc8的原创作品,请联系作者获取转载授权,否则将追究法律责任 1、config对象概述 对应javax.servlet.ServletConfig.class对象。具体参照笔者文章:ServletConfig小解。 赞 收藏 评论 分享 举报 上一篇:JSP九大内置对象详解全析(八):pageContext对象 下一篇:JSP九大内置对象详解全析(六):pageContext对象 提问和评论都可以,用心的回复会被更多人看到 评论 发布评论 全部评论 () 最热 最新 相关文章 【面向对象设计的七大原则】 (文章目录)前言面向对象设计(OOD)是现代软件工程中的核心,其核心思想在于通过抽象化实体的特征和行为来模拟现实世界,这种方法不仅仅是一种编程范式,更是一种设计哲学。在编程领域,它帮助开发者通过类和对象的组织和交互,来构建出模块化、灵活且易于维护的软件系统。而面向对象设计的七大原则,常被称为“OOD七大宝典”,它们分别是单一职责原则(SRP)、开闭原则(OCP)、里氏替换原则(LSP)、依赖倒 python 子类 单一职责原则 JS attributes对象(元素属性对象)+BOM(浏览器对象模型)+Screen对象 1、JS attributes对象(元素属性对象):元素属性是指在 HTML 元素的开始标签中用来控制标签行为或提供标签信息的特殊词语。在 HTML DOM 中,通过 attributes 对象来表示 HTML 属性,在 attributes 对象中提供了多种添加、修改和删除 HTML 属性的方法属性 / 方法 : 描述attributes.isId : 如果属性是 ID 类型,则返回 tr HTML java html 【C++入门到精通】C++入门 —— 类和对象(构造函数、析构函数) 一、类的6个默认成员函数二、构造函数⭕构造函数概念⭕构造函数的特点⭕常见构造函数的几种类型三、析构函数⭕析构函数概念⭕析构函数的特点⭕常见析构函数的几种类型 析构函数 构造函数 虚析构函数 JSP九大内置对象详解全析(八):pageContext对象 1、page对象概述 代表当前的JSP页面,只有在当前的JSP页面内才是合法的。类似JAVA中的this指针。它是java.lang.Object类的实例。常用方法: 方法 返回值 说明 getClass() Object 返回当前的Object类 hashCode() Object 返回当前的Object类的哈希码 toSt Servlet JSP 内置对象 page JSP九大内置对象详解全析(六):pageContext对象 1、pageContext对象概述 pageContext对象的创建和初始化由容器来完成。在JSP页面可以直接使用这个对象。该对象的作用是可以获取任何范围内的参数,通过它可以获得JSP页面的out、request、response、session、application对象。对应javax.servlet.jsp.PageContext.class对象。常用方法如下: Servlet JSP 内置对象 pageContext JSP九大内置对象详解全析(九):exception对象 1、exception对象概述 该对象的作用是显示异常信息。exception 对象的作用是显示异常信息,只有在包含 isErrorPage=”true” 的页面中才可以被使用,在一般的JSP页面中使用该对象将无法编译JSP文件。 excepation对象和Java的所有对象一样,都具有系统提供的继承 结构。exception对象是java.lang.Throwable的对象。 Servlet JSP 内置对象 exception对象 JSP九大内置对象详解全析(三):session对象 1、session对象概述 session对象是由服务器自动创建与用户请求相关的对象。服务器会为每一个用户创建一个session对象用来保存用户信息,跟踪用户操作。该对象内部使用Map类来保存数据,因此它的数据类型是key-value形式。对应javax.servlet.http.HttpSession.class对象。 服务器为不同的浏览器在内存中创建用于保存数据的对象叫seesio Servlet session jsp JSP JSP九大内置对象详解全析(五):application对象 1、out对象概述 out对象用在web浏览器内输出信息,并且管理应用服务器上的输出缓冲区。在使用该对象输出数据时,可以对数据缓冲区进行操作,及时清理缓冲区的残余数据,为其他的输出让出缓冲空间。待数据输出完毕后,要及时关闭输出流。常用的方法如下: 方法 返回值 说明 clear() void 清除缓冲区内容 clearBuffer() v Servlet JSP out 内置对象 JSP九大内置对象详解全析(四):application对象 1、application对象概述 application对象作用范围是整个项目,该对象提供了项目环境属性的访问方法。比如在web.xml文件中,提供的初始化参数(标签),连接数据库的URL、用户名、密码。对应javax.servlet.ServletConfig.class对象。application对象常用的方法如下: 方法 返回值 说明 getAttr Servlet JSP application JSP九大内置对象详解全析(二):respone对象 1、respone对象概述 respone对象只在JSP页面生效。该对象主要是将JSP容器(Servlet容器)处理过的内容传回客户端。对应javax.servlet.http.HttpServletResponse对象。 2、重定向网页 重定向是通过sendRed Servlet respon对象 JSP JSP九大内置对象详解全析(一):request对象 在JSP中采用了java作脚本编写语言,这样使页面具有了强大的对象处理能力,还可以动态的创建web页面内容。在java中每次使用一个对象都要预先实例化,在页面编程中这是很繁琐的事情。JSP为我们封装好了页面编程过程中常使用到的九大对象:request、response、session、application、out、pagecontext、config、page、exception。这些对象在JS Servlet jsp 九大对象 JSP 详解JSP九大内置对象 内置对象:就是在JSP中无需创建就可使用的称为内置对象,它是有容器创建的(如Tomcat、JBoss、weblgic等容器创建)。JSP九大内置对象分别为:out、request、response、session、application、pageContext、page、config、exception。1、out对象 向客户端输出信息,它是JspWriter类的一个实例。& request response 内置对象 jsp-九大内置对象 四种存储数据的容器对象:page、request、session、application(1)page对象是java.lang.Object类的一个实例。它指的是JSP实现类的实例,也就是说它是JSP本身,通过这个对象可以对它进行访问。JSP实现了类对象的一个句柄,只有在JSP页面的范围内才是合法的。(2)request对象是ServletRequest的一个实例。当客户端提交一个请求时,JSP引 session page request jsp中的九大内置对象详解 <%@ page contentType="text/html;charset=UTF-8" language="java" %><html><head> <title>Title</title></head><body><%--jsp中有9大对象--%><% /*四大域对象*/ request.setAttribute("user", "gavin"); . java html java代码 其他 JSP的九大内置对象 定义:可以不加声明就在JSP页面脚本(Java程序片和Java表达式)中使用的 JSP共有以下9种基本内置组件(可与ASP的6种内部组件相对应): 1. 客户端的请求信息被封装在中,通过它才能了解到客户的需求,然后做出响应。它是HttpServletRequest类的实例。 序号 方 法 说 明 1 object  JSP 内置对象 &nbs JSP九大内置对象详解 JSP中一共预先定义了9个这样的对象,分别为:request、response、session、application、out、pagecontext、config、page、exception1、request对象request 对象是 javax.servlet.httpServletReque... jsp页面 服务器 数据 初始化 客户端 Thread 为何会触发onResume 首先我们先增加一个公用方法DoSomethingLong(string name),这个方法下面的举例中都有可能用到1 #region Private Method 2 /// <summary> 3 /// 一个比较耗时耗资源的私有方法 4 /// </summary> 5 /// <param name="name"></param& 线程池 后台线程 代码注释 ios开发者 相机权限 前天把备机小米6从miui10开发版升级到了miui11最新开发版。之前的miui10,安装过谷歌相机,升级完成重启后,发现打开谷歌相机闪退。 miui11 9.11.14开发版 系统自带的root也已经被关闭,难道还要刷第三方Recovery?刷root?各种变砖卡顿的画面在脑海中闪现啊!!!今天一大早强迫症开始作祟,折腾吧,之前miui论坛由于关闭好多帖子已经看不到细节,网上也有不少 ios开发者 相机权限 小米谷歌框架 重启 开发版 闪退 shell function 定义 函数函数可以让我们将一个复杂功能划分成若干模块,让程序结构更加清晰,代码重复利用率更高。像其他编程语言一样,Shell 也支持函数。Shell 函数必须先定义后使用。Shell 函数的定义格式如下:function_name () { list of commands [ return value ] }如果你愿意,也可以在函数名前加上关键字 function:function f shell function 定义 Linux Shell 函数 函数参数 spring aop 切面方法参数 带着问题去阅读什么是面向切面编程?(是什么+为什么)如何使用AOP?(怎么用)什么是AOP?AOP,全称:Aspect Oriented Programming,即面向切面编程。它最早是在1997年的面向对象编程大会上提出来的概念,并于2001年在AspectJ中得到首次实践。与面向对象OOP不同的是,AOP并不是将程序抽象成各个层次的对象,而是将程序抽象成一个一个的切面。何为切面?简单的理解,就 spring aop 切面方法参数 aop spring java 编程语言 python 接口自动化 如何获取上游接口多个参数 传递给下游 实现自定义接口任务1 创建软件包在工作区目录中,创建一个包,并在其中创建一个文件夹来存放 msg 文件:srcmore_interfaces ros2 pkg create --build-type ament_cmake more_interfaces mkdir more_interfaces/msg 2 创建 msg 文件在里面,创建一个新文件more_interfaces/msgAddr 自动驾驶 机器人 #include 字符串 xml